  • Title

    Index assignment in vector quantisation for channels with memory

  • Abstract
    The study presents a formulation of a Hadamard framework for analysing the vector quantisation over channels with memory. In seeking faster response, classes of index assignments are defined in terms of the Hadamard transform of channel transition probabilities. An index assignment algorithm is developed that achieves high robustness against channel errors, and its performance in vector quantisation of Gauss-Markov sources under noisy channel conditions is illustrated.
